When planning a cruise, there are countless ways to enhance your experience — from choosing the perfect stateroom to booking exciting excursions. But one optional add-on stands out as both a convenience and a value-packed perk: the drink package.

Many cruisers wonder if a drink package is worth the cost, and the answer often depends on your personal preferences and vacation style. Whether you’re a morning coffee lover, a cocktail adventurer, or someone who simply enjoys the convenience of not worrying about every drink charge, here are some of the best benefits and advantages of purchasing a drink package on your next cruise.

1. Freedom to Explore New Drinks

One of the biggest perks of a drink package is the opportunity to step outside your comfort zone and try drinks you might not normally order. Whether it’s a tropical Mai Tai, a classic Old Fashioned, or a specialty martini, you can sample a variety of cocktails without worrying about the price tag adding up.

Many cruise lines also offer drink menus that rotate daily at different bars, giving you even more chances to discover your new favorite sip.

2. Specialty Coffees and Teas Included

It’s not just about the alcohol! Most premium drink packages also cover specialty coffees and teas, meaning you can start your mornings with a cappuccino, latte, or flavored iced coffee — all made by trained baristas. It’s a luxury touch that makes your mornings onboard feel extra special, especially when paired with a sunrise view from the deck.

3. Unlimited Bottled Water for Convenience

Staying hydrated is essential, especially when exploring ports or spending time in the sun. With a drink package, you can grab unlimited bottled water to take along on excursions, keep in your stateroom, or sip by the pool. No need to ration or worry about extra charges for something so basic — your water needs are covered.

4. Stress-Free Ordering

Without a drink package, you might find yourself mentally calculating each drink’s cost throughout your trip — or even skipping that second cocktail to save money. With a package, every drink is pre-paid, so you can relax and order freely without thinking about your tab.

This kind of financial freedom enhances the overall cruise experience, letting you focus on enjoying yourself rather than budgeting every beverage.

5. Works at Most Bars and Restaurants

Whether you’re poolside, at a specialty restaurant, or dancing the night away in the nightclub, your drink package usually works across the ship. You’ll never feel limited to certain locations, and many packages also cover drinks at private island destinations (depending on the cruise line), so your beach day cocktails are included, too.

6. Great for Group Travel or Celebrations

If you’re cruising with friends and family, a drink package lets everyone enjoy celebratory toasts without awkwardly splitting bills or feeling hesitant about ordering another round. Whether it’s a mimosa brunch, a wine tasting at dinner, or nightcaps under the stars, your celebrations flow effortlessly.

7. Potential Savings — Especially on Longer Cruises

If you plan to enjoy several drinks each day — even just a morning coffee, an afternoon cocktail, wine at dinner, and a nightcap — the per-day cost of a drink package often works out to significant savings over paying à la carte. Add in bottled water and specialty coffees, and the value becomes even clearer.

Final Sip: Is a Drink Package Right for You?

A drink package isn’t for everyone, but for many cruisers, it adds convenience, luxury, and fun to the sailing. Whether you’re a wine connoisseur, coffee enthusiast, cocktail explorer, or just someone who wants a stress-free vacation, it’s worth considering.
